| Our guide Tad was lots of fun and very accommodating to our rather unusual group. I was accompanied by my 30 year old niece from Washington D.C. and my 85 year old father from the Chicago area. My niece had never spent time in Chicago and thoroughly enjoyed herself. My father enjoyed the walk down memory lane (as he worked in the city most of his working life and has been retired almost 30 years) but certainly would have appreciated a shorter lane. He came hungry as suggested but found the first food tasting a tad too long into the tour. I enjoyed the tour but would have liked to see more variety in the food tasted. If you enjoy walking and want to see a lot of the city, I highly recommend this tour. Be warned, the tour end is over 2 miles from where the tour started! |

| My mom and I are from Michigan. We attended this event with my friend and her mother who are from Florida. The tour was alot of fun and it gave us an opportunity to see a great deal of Chicago and it's unique neighborhoods in the surrounding area of busy Michigan Avenue. One word of advice though, it takes alot longer than an hour to return to where you begin the tour if you're walking. Also I believe the tour walk covered more than two miles. We're all pretty physically fit and were exhausted by the time we walked back to the starting destination.
Our comments regarding the food we sampled: The Jewish Deli: I would rather have tried some of the deli meats over the greasy potatoe pancake.
We really enjoyed the tea, pizza and chocolate. (A sample of fudge at the fudge pot would have been preferred over the butter toffee) most people think you will sample fudge with a name like the fudge pot.
Our guide Shane was extremely knowledgeable and a real pleasure to spend three hours with. He is enthusiastic and thoroughly enjoys his job as a tour guide. |

| We did the planetfood tour on Saturday June 9th. The tour takes you through many interesting neighborhoods in and around the Loop area. I especially enjoyed going to the tea shop, the spice shop and the Fudge Pot. Our guide provided good info and background on the areas and homes we passed by. I would recommend the tour to anyone who likes to walk, enjoys history and is interested in finding out about good places to eat with the locals.
